服务器测试流程和工具是什么,深入解析服务器测试流程及常用工具,保障服务器稳定运行的关键
- 综合资讯
- 2025-03-30 04:47:46
- 2

服务器测试流程包括环境搭建、性能测试、稳定性测试和安全性测试等环节,常用工具如JMeter、LoadRunner等,通过模拟真实用户访问,评估服务器性能,深入解析这些流...
服务器测试流程包括环境搭建、性能测试、稳定性测试和安全性测试等环节,常用工具如JMeter、LoadRunner等,通过模拟真实用户访问,评估服务器性能,深入解析这些流程和工具,有助于保障服务器稳定运行。
随着互联网技术的飞速发展,服务器作为企业核心IT基础设施,其稳定性和性能直接影响到业务的正常运行,为了确保服务器能够满足业务需求,提高服务质量,服务器测试成为必不可少的环节,本文将详细介绍服务器测试流程及常用工具,帮助您更好地保障服务器稳定运行。
图片来源于网络,如有侵权联系删除
服务器测试流程
测试计划制定
在开始服务器测试之前,首先需要制定详细的测试计划,测试计划应包括以下内容:
(1)测试目标:明确测试的目的,如性能测试、稳定性测试、安全测试等。
(2)测试范围:确定测试对象,包括硬件、软件、网络等。
(3)测试环境:描述测试所需的硬件、软件、网络等环境。
(4)测试方法:确定测试方法,如功能测试、性能测试、压力测试等。
(5)测试资源:列出测试过程中所需的资源,如测试人员、测试工具等。
测试环境搭建
根据测试计划,搭建测试环境,测试环境应尽可能模拟生产环境,包括硬件、软件、网络等方面。
测试用例设计
根据测试目标,设计测试用例,测试用例应涵盖服务器各个方面,包括功能、性能、安全、稳定性等。
测试执行
按照测试用例执行测试,记录测试结果,在测试过程中,注意以下几点:
(1)遵循测试流程,确保测试的连贯性。
(2)关注异常情况,及时处理问题。
(3)记录测试数据,为后续分析提供依据。
测试结果分析
对测试结果进行分析,找出存在的问题,并制定相应的解决方案,分析内容包括:
(1)功能测试:验证服务器功能是否满足需求。
(2)性能测试:评估服务器性能,如响应时间、吞吐量等。
(3)稳定性测试:验证服务器在长时间运行下的稳定性。
(4)安全测试:检测服务器是否存在安全漏洞。
图片来源于网络,如有侵权联系删除
测试报告编写
根据测试结果,编写测试报告,测试报告应包括以下内容:
(1)测试目的和范围。
(2)测试方法。
(3)测试结果。
(4)问题及解决方案。
(5)测试结论。
服务器测试工具
功能测试工具
(1)Selenium:一款开源的自动化测试工具,支持多种编程语言。
(2)QTP(UFT):一款商业自动化测试工具,适用于多种操作系统。
性能测试工具
(1)JMeter:一款开源的性能测试工具,适用于Web、Java、数据库等。
(2)LoadRunner:一款商业性能测试工具,适用于多种操作系统。
稳定性测试工具
(1)Apptainer:一款开源的稳定性测试工具,适用于Web、Java、数据库等。
(2)NUnit:一款开源的单元测试框架,适用于多种编程语言。
安全测试工具
(1)Nessus:一款开源的安全漏洞扫描工具。
(2)Burp Suite:一款商业安全测试工具,适用于Web应用。
服务器测试是保障服务器稳定运行的关键环节,通过以上对服务器测试流程及常用工具的介绍,相信您已经对服务器测试有了更深入的了解,在实际工作中,根据业务需求选择合适的测试工具,遵循测试流程,确保服务器测试工作的高效、有序进行。
本文链接:https://www.zhitaoyun.cn/1944184.html
发表评论